Valluerca is a very small village in Spain. It is located in the Álava province, which is part of the Basque Country. Valluerca is about 65 kilometers south of the large city of Bilbao. In 2007, only seven people lived there.

Where is Valluerca Located?
Valluerca is found in the Valdegovía municipality. This area is in the western part of Álava. The province of Álava is one of three provinces in the Basque Country. The Basque Country is an autonomous community in northern Spain.
